U.S. launched airstrikes against IS targets in Libya’s Sirte

2 августа, 2016 17:25

Dushanbe, 02.08.2016. /NIAT “Khovar”/. The U.S. launched the first airstrikes against the Islamic State (IS) targets in the Libyan city of Sirte, at the request of Libya’s UN-brokered government, the prime minister said in a televised speech.
“The first airstrikes were carried out on precise positions of the IS in Sirte, causing heavy losses”, — Prime Minister Fayez al-Sarraj said.
He said the airstrikes would be limited to Sirte and its surroundings.
In Washington, Pentagon confirmed the operation in a statement, saying «additional U.S. strikes will continue to target IS in Sirte in order to enable the Government of National Accord (GNA) to make a decisive, strategic advance.»
“The U.S. stands with the international community in supporting the GNA as it strives to restore stability and security to Libya,” — the statement said.
It said the strikes were authorized by U.S. President Barack Obama.
According to Xinhua, since May, Libya’s UN-backed government have been striking the IS targets in Sirte, about 450 kilometers east of the capital city Tripoli.
